Question

Which two access categories could use TXOP value higher than 0, as per 802.11e standard? (Choose two.)

Options

  • AAC_VO
  • BAC_BK
  • CAC_VI
  • DAC_BE
  • EAC_NC

Explanation

Under 802.11e/WMM, TXOP (Transmission Opportunity) grants a station a bounded time window to send multiple frames; only AC_VO and AC_VI are assigned non-zero TXOP values by default to support time-sensitive traffic.

Common mistakes.

  • B. AC_BK (Background) has a TXOP limit of 0 in the standard EDCA defaults, meaning each transmission requires a separate channel contention cycle.
  • D. AC_BE (Best Effort) also has a TXOP limit of 0 by default, as best-effort traffic does not require the burst transmission efficiency that voice and video need.
  • E. AC_NC is not a defined 802.11e access category; the standard defines only AC_VO, AC_VI, AC_BE, and AC_BK.
